Professional Services Administrator - Our client, an independent property consultancy firm, is seeking a Professional Services Administrator to support a small friendly team on a full time, permanent basis with the main duties of the role being welcoming and directing visitors, coordinating meetings and appointments and performing clerical tasks, like answering phones and responding to emails.
Responsibilities- Act as a first point of contact for incoming telephone calls, emails and visitors to the office, logging and responding to routine customer enquiries in a professional and timely manner.
- Accurately record customer maintenance issues and service concerns raised by customers, providing updates regarding reported repairs, contractor attendance and ongoing actions.
- Escalate complex matters or complaints to the relevant Property Manager where required.
- Assist with the preparation and issuance of resident communications, notices and general correspondence.
- Liaise with contractors to arrange attendance, obtain updates and monitor completion of works following up instructions in writing and maintain accurate records on company systems.
- Support the administration of recurring services such as cleaning, gardening and other contracts.
- Provide day-to-day administrative support to the Property Management team.
- Maintain accurate electronic records, including contractor instruction, correspondence and compliance documentation.
- Assist with document preparation, scanning, filing, mail merges and general office administration.
- Support the administration of insurance claims and related correspondence where required.
- Assist with updating databases, key registers and property records.
- Manage key control processes including issuing and signing keys in and out of the office.
- Assist in controlling visitor access to the office and maintaining a professional reception environment.
- Work collaboratively with Property Managers and other team members to support service delivery during periods of absence or high workload.
- Maintain confidentiality and handle sensitive information appropriately.
- Ensure all communication is professional, accurate and customer focused.
- Follow company procedures, health and safety requirements and data protection obligations.
- Participate in training and team meetings as required.
- Support continuous improvement in administrative processes and customer service standards.
